#328112 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#328112 is composed of 19.6% red, 50.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 28.8%. #328112 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ff24 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#328112 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#328112 has RGB values of R:50, G:129,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3309842.

Shades and Tints of #328112
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030901 is the darkest color, while #f8f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#328112
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484e45 is the less saturated color, while #2b9201 is the most saturated one.
